🔍 What is Operational Risk in Asset Management?

Operational risk refers to the potential for loss or performance disruption caused by failed internal systems, ineffective people or processes, and unpredictable external events. In asset management, this could mean:

  • Maintenance errors
  • Software malfunctions
  • Poor data accuracy
  • Failure to follow regulatory frameworks (like RERA)
  • Infrastructure damage from environmental or utility issues

While financial or market risks often take center stage, operational risk is far more immediate and controllable—if approached proactively.

🛠️ Common Sources of Operational Risk

Here’s a breakdown of the most frequent operational risk categories in asset-heavy businesses:

Risk Category Examples
Human Error Incorrect data entry, delayed inspections, unsafe handling
System Failures Asset tracking software glitches, sensor downtime, cybersecurity lapses
Process Gaps No SOPs, inaccurate lifecycle documentation, unclear asset ownership
Compliance Issues Missed renewals, RERA violations, environmental non-conformance
External Events Power outages, extreme weather, transport & logistics disruptions

These vulnerabilities are present across industries including logistics, real estate, manufacturing, and hospitality—especially in high-growth environments like Dubai.


✅ 7 Proven Strategies to Reduce Operational Risk
1. Implement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s)

Clear SOPs are foundational to reducing risk. They standardize operations, ensure accountability, and eliminate ambiguity.

Best Practice: Maintain version-controlled documentation, and review SOPs annually to keep them aligned with business changes.


2. Invest in Continuous Staff Training

A well-informed team is your first line of defense. Consistent training reduces errors and increases system utilization.

Topics Should Include:

  • Asset management software
  • Safety and compliance protocols
  • Emergency response procedures

3. Adopt Predictive Maintenance Tools

Gone are the days of waiting for an asset to fail. Predictive maintenance leverages IoT sensors, AI algorithms, and historical data to flag early warning signs.

Benefits Include:

  • Fewer breakdowns
  • Extended asset life
  • Reduced maintenance costs

Dubai businesses that adopt these systems reduce asset downtime by up to 30% annually.


4. Conduct Routine Compliance Audits

With constant regulatory updates in the UAE, especially under RERA, compliance gaps can easily form. Scheduled audits help avoid penalties, legal action, or asset shutdowns.

Focus Areas:

  • Documentation accuracy
  • Health, safety, and environmental compliance
  • RERA-approved tenancy and maintenance standards

5. Centralize Asset Data with Smart Software

Scattered spreadsheets and offline systems increase the risk of oversight. A centralized Asset Management System (AMS) ensures visibility, consistency, and audit-readiness.

What to Look For:

  • Real-time asset status updates
  • Maintenance scheduling
  • User access control
  • Integration with ERP or IoT platforms

6. Disaster Recovery & Business Continuity Planning

External shocks—from power failures to cyberattacks—can severely impact asset performance. Having a disaster recovery plan ensures you bounce back quickly.

Core Components:

  • Data backup systems
  • Contingency workflows
  • Communication protocols
  • Asset insurance reviews

Pro Tip: Run simulation drills bi-annually.
